Why These Are the Top Windows Contractors in Franktown

** The windows market in and around Franktown, VA, is typical of a rural coastal area. There are few, if any, contractors physically located within Franktown itself, requiring residents to rely on businesses in neighboring commercial hubs like Exmore and Onley. The competition, while not dense, consists of established local companies and a few regional chains, all of which are accustomed to the specific demands of the Eastern Shore climate, including high winds, salt air, and humidity. Service quality is generally high, with an emphasis on craftsmanship and durability. Pricing is competitive but can be on the higher side for custom or high-performance energy-efficient models. The most successful providers are those with deep local roots, strong reputations for reliability, and expertise in both modern replacements and the preservation of the region's historic homes.

2How does Franktown's climate impact the type of windows I should choose?

Franktown experiences hot, humid summers and cool winters, making energy efficiency a top priority. We highly recommend windows with Low-E glass and argon gas fills to reflect summer heat and retain winter warmth, reducing strain on your HVAC system. Given our region's potential for strong storms, selecting windows with a high Design Pressure (DP) rating for wind and impact resistance is also a wise investment for long-term durability.

4What is the best time of year to schedule window installation in Franktown, and how long does the project usually take?

The ideal installation periods in our area are late spring and early fall, avoiding the peak humidity of summer and the freezing temperatures of winter. For a typical whole-home project, the installation itself usually takes 1-3 days, but you should plan for a total project timeline of 4-8 weeks from signing a contract to completion to account for manufacturing lead times and scheduling.

5How can I verify a window installation company is reputable and reliable in the Franktown area?

Always check for a valid Virginia Class A, B, or C contractor's license and proof of insurance. Seek out companies with strong, verifiable local references in Franklin County and read reviews on trusted local platforms. A reputable provider will offer a detailed, written estimate, a strong warranty on both product and labor, and will be knowledgeable about the specific weather and architectural considerations of homes in our community.
